Location and surroundings

Loch is a dry meadow in Switzerland. The site lies near Lauenen b. Gstaad in the canton of BE. It covers 1 ha. In the federal inventory it carries object number 5908. Dry meadow: what is it?

Dry meadows and pastures are nutrient-poor, sunny grasslands of exceptional biodiversity, created only by traditional management.

Is Loch protected?

Yes. The site is listed in the federal inventory and is therefore of national importance.
